Natural England (NE) delivers a wide range of farm advice, including the Catchment Sensitive Farming Programme (CSF). CSF provides advice to farmers to reduce diffuse water and air pollution from agriculture, natural hazards (floods) and supports farms through agricultural transition. The programme operates through a network of locally based CSF farm advisers and partner organisations to deliver Defra’s 25‑year plan for water quality, air quality (ammonia) and sustainable water management through nature‑based solutions.
